Lance Neven
Alabama / East Coast
When he was 22 years old, Coach Neven was the youngest high school head coach in Alabama.
He was on the Auburn University strength and conditioning staff for 1988-89, and the following year he was a strength coach at UMS-Wright.
He has been coaching the BFS program since 1986.
"Our motto in the Southeast is 'Leave it ALL on the field'," says Neven. "We are going to give it everything we got each and every day to help Communities, Schools, Coaches and ESPECIALLY the ATHLETES to WIN."
